网站在百度搜索引擎的排名无疑是每一个中文SEOer最为关心的问题。网上关于影响百度排名的因素有很多,今天笔者就来总结一下,影响百度搜索引擎排名的站内因素。
第一,域名与服务器空间。服务器空间的稳定与否决定了网站对于百度搜索引擎的友好程度。网站打开的速度对于搜索引擎同样至关重要。很多时候一些外国的服务器空间打开网站的速度就比较慢。在说到细化,甚至于两个不同地区的服务器对于网站排名同样有影响。比如你的关键词是温州XXX,如果你的服务器空间在温州,很明显,你将会比服务器空间在北京或者其他地区的网站更具有优势。
第二,整体架构。实践证明,百度搜索引擎对于树形架构的网站的友好性是比较高的。很多读者对于树形架构的概念可能还是比较模糊,笔者就来解释一下。所谓的树形结构就是说网站整体呈现一个树叉状的一个结构。
一定要把握好将网站的首页放在服务器的一级目录,二级页面就放在服务器的二级页面,三级详细页同样放在服务器的三级目录。
第三,代码。现在主流的网站制作程序有很多种。但是无论是ASP还是.NET亦或者是PHP,就目前的搜索引擎技术而言,静态的程序才是王道。动态的网站很难被SPIDER抓取。然后就是页面的代码了,互联网的技术不断的更新,很多老式的代码都已经被淘汰,FLASH标签,frame标签,table标签等都不在符合搜索引擎的标准了。而在代码中的title、keywords、description标签则在网站中起着至关重要的作用。因为这三要素是SPIDER在爬行一个页面的时候第一个要读取的东西,可以理解为第一印象。然后就是代码中的H1、H2、H3标签了,代码中在这里标签里适当添加关键词能增加关键词与你网站的相关度,搜索引擎会认为这个词对于你网站是重要的,从而让你网站这个词的排名更好。然后就是代码的风格了。很多程序员在写程序的时候代码非常乱,完全没有排版,代码异常乱。导致SPRIDER读取的时候非常的费力,当然就会留下坏印象了。最后就是一些图片信息的处理了。目前的搜索引擎还不能读取图片信息,它唯一能理解的就是图片的ALT属性,虽然这只是一个小细节,但是堆积起来就是一个大问题了。
第四,内容。内容的建设对于网站至关重要,对于网站在百度上的排名有着直接的关系。随着搜索引擎的日益发展,伪原创的东西也已经站不住脚。内容与关键字的契合度加上网站自身的质量(评价网站质量的标准只要包括架构、代码、速度、服务器空间等)将是关键词在搜索引擎的第一决定因素。
第五,robots文件。搜索引擎的SPIDER在爬行到你网站的时候第一个把关的就是robots文件。它里面的内容将决定你网站的哪些内容是允许被抓取,什么内容是不允许被抓取的。而对于抓取到的内容SPIDER会根据它在服务器上的位置(相对于的目录等级)分配不同的权重。所以说,树形结构对于网站权重的集中起到了决定性的作用。
第六,内链。都说外链为皇,其实内链的作用同样重要。一直以来,网站都有种说话叫做扁平化的结构。很多读者同样不理解什么是扁平化。其实,通俗来讲,扁平化结构就是让SRIDER能通过最短的跳转到达你网站的任何一个页面。举个例子,一个网站有很多文章100篇,而每个页面只能有10篇,要到达第五十篇的时候如何能最快到达,而不是下一页,下一页点五十下。当你能越快到达你的第50篇文章就是扁平化了。当然这只是内链的一个方面。最为典型的就是面包屑标签。我们经常在一个详细页的左上角可以看到一段小的导航类标签就是面包屑标签了。它的存在就是为了传递权重。当你网站的一篇内容质量比较高的时候,SPIDER就会根据你网站的面包屑标签将这篇内容的权重传递到相对应的上级目录。百度所谓的“外链”其实并不是传统的外链,而是相关域。通过domain:www.xxx.com 你会发现,其实很多网站的二级页面也是存在的。所以说内链的建设也异常重要,决定了网站的流通性。当SPIDER爬行到你的页面时,就很可能通过内链爬到另外一个页面。
第七,网站地图。一个网站的网站地图如同它的说明书一样。爬行蜘蛛通过网站地图可以轻易到达每一个页面。